When Specialized developed the new S-Works Tarmac Disc, they didn't just want it to be fast. No, they wanted it to be fast everywhere. Long climbs, windy flats, Grand Tour stages, and local fondos—the result is a bike built to be the most complete out there. And now with disc brakes, it's managed to get even more complete.

For the construction, we utilized advanced aerospace composite optimization software to revolutionize the construction and layup of our new FACT 12r carbon. It's the most advanced material, and schedule, we've ever made and this allowed us to shed nearly 200 grams. That's right, a 20% reduction in frame weight—the perfect recipe for your next hill climb PR.

Major steps have been taken to improve the Rider-First Engineered™ technology, ensuring that the new Tarmac is stiff and compliant in exactly the right places, all while shedding some serious weight. From different layup schedules and materials, to visibly different forks, every single aspect of the new Tarmac has been scrutinized to ensure you're getting the perfect ride. With this revamp, the Tarmac also gets an updated geometry, basing it on countless Retül data points and professional rider input. This enabled Specialized to develop a Performance Road Geometry that perfects the combination of a responsive front end and short wheelbase, which delivers instantaneous response and optimal power transfer.

And while stiffness aids in the aforementioned, compliance must also be utilized for an optimal ride quality. That's why Specialized designed a seatpost that builds compliance into the upper 120mm where clamping doesn't happen, dropped the seatstays, and altered the seat tube shape. We also added tire clearance up to 30mm, which translates to a 28mm Turbo Cotton on a Roval CLX 50 Disc wheel. This allows lower pressures for decreased rolling resistance, increased traction, and more comfort. Altogether, these additions still have the Specialized Tarmac riding like a true race-machine, but it also takes a bit of the sting out of road imperfections.

But why disc brakes? The real question is "why not?" They offer superior braking power and modulation, work exceptionally well in wet weather, and offer a very, very minor weight addition. All this means that you have more control and can go faster with more confidence.

Specialized also know, however, that aerodynamic improvements are the most important thing they can do to make you faster. Both Bora-Hansgrohe and Team Quick-Step Floors Pro Tour riders, after all, are demanding aero improvements on every bike. With this, the aero goal was to discover where they could essentially "add aero for free," by not taking anything away from the hallmarks of the Tarmac design. During the six-month iterative process, three areas were discovered where this could be done—a new fork shape, dropped seatstays with aero tubes, and a D-shaped seatpost and seat tube. The result? A bike that's approximately 45 seconds faster over 40km compared to other lightweight bikes in the same category.

Next, the 2018 Tarmac Disc includes the lightest (440g/172.5mm) and most accurate power meter available, because no matter your skill level or experience on the bike, there's no better way to enhance your training and racing performance than by riding with a power meter. Lucky for you, it combines the incredibly light and stiff carbon fiber S-Works road cranks with dual-sided power measurement.

This S-Works Tarmac Disc comes ready to race with Shimano's new Dura-Ace 9170 Di2 groupset with disc brakes, and the lightweight, yet impressively aerodynamic, Roval CLX 50 Disc wheels with 26mm Turbo Cotton tires.

Specialized S-Works Tarmac Disc 2018 Features

  • Featuring our Rider-First Engineered™ design that ensures every frame size has the same legendary climbing responsiveness and descending prowess you'd expect from a Tarmac. The S-Works FACT 12r frameset is the highest quality carbon frame, offering the ideal blend of light overall weight and targeted stiffness.
  • S-Works full FACT carbon fork with a tapered construction provides incredible front end stiffness and steering response for instantaneous accelerations and high-speed descents.
  • Specialized have combined the incredibly light and stiff, carbon fiber S-Works road cranks with dual-sided power measurement, making it the lightest (440g/172.5mm) and most accurate (+/- 1%) power meter available.

2018 S-Works Tarmac Disc Spec Highlights

  • Shimano Dura Ace Di2 9150 11-speed groupset (11-30t, 52/36t)
  • Shimano Dura Ace 9170 hydraulic disc brakes
  • Roval XLC 50 Disc Carbon wheelset with Turbo Cotton tyres
  • S-Works Power Cranks, dual-sided power meter.
  • S-Works Cockpit
Technical Information
Frame
S-Works Tarmac SL6, FACT 12r carbon, Rider-First Engineered™, OSBB, clean routing, Di2 specific, internally integrated seat clamp, 12x142mm thru-axle, flat-mount disc
Fork
S-Works FACT carbon, 12x100mm, thru-axle
Front Wheel
Roval CLX 50 Disc, carbon, tubeless-ready, Win Tunnel Engineered, 50mm depth, CeramicSpeed bearings, 21h
Rear Wheel
Roval CLX 50 Disc, carbon, tubeless-ready, Win Tunnel Engineered, 50mm depth, DT Swiss 240 internals, CeramicSpeed bearings, 24h
Inner Tubes
60mm Turbo tube w/ Talc
Front Tyre
Turbo Cotton, 700x26mm, 320 TPI
Rear Tyre
Turbo Cotton, 700x26mm, 320 TPI
Crankset
S-Works Power Cranks, dual-sided power measurement, +/- 1.5% accuracy
Chainrings
52/36T
Bottom Bracket
OSBB, CeramicSpeed bearings
Shifters
Shimano Dura-Ace Di2 Disc 9170
Front Derailleur
Shimano Dura-Ace Di2 9150, braze-on
Rear Derailleur
Shimano Dura-Ace Di2 9150, 11-speed
Cassette
Shimano Dura-Ace 9100, 11-speed, 11-30t
Chain
Shimano Dura-Ace,11-speed
Front Brake
Shimano Dura-Ace Di2 9170, hydraulic disc
Rear Brake
Shimano Dura-Ace Di2 9170, hydraulic disc
Handlebars
S-Works SL Carbon Shallow Drop, 125x75mm
Tape
S-Wrap w/ Sticky gel
Stem
S-Works SL, alloy, titanium bolts, 6-degree rise
Saddle
S-Works Toupé, Body Geometry shape, 143mm width, carbon rails
Seatpost
S-Works FACT Carbon Tarmac seatpost, 20mm offset
Seat Binder
Tarmac SL6 clamp assembly
